What is Arcade Fitness Bike & Run?
Arcade Fitness is a gamified indoor cycling and running app that uses 3D virtual worlds to track workouts on iOS.
Users hire the app to turn repetitive treadmill or bike sessions into interactive gaming experiences, reducing the perceived effort of indoor training.

What Are The Key Features?
Provides five distinct settings for workouts, including track, steeple, trail, castle, and space.
Supports Bluetooth Smart heart rate monitors to sync physical effort with in-game character speed.
Enables users to compete against friends in real-time virtual races.

The rivals identified
Nemeses(1)
TrainerRoad competes for the same indoor cycling audience by offering structured, power-based training plans that demand high user engagement and performance tracking.
Differentiators
- Adaptive Training engine uses machine learning to dynamically adjust workout intensity based on user performance data
- Deep integration with power meters and smart trainers provides precise, data-driven training feedback for serious athletes
- Comprehensive library of structured, science-based training plans designed to improve specific cycling physiological markers over time
Head to head
The target should lean into its 'fun' factor and low-friction entry, avoiding a direct feature war with TrainerRoad's complex performance analytics.
